Ethan’s world is once again turned upside down in Resident Evil 8. Luckily, Chris Redfield swoops in to save Ethan, and his life regains some normality, if not for long. We first meet Ethan in Resident Evil 7, when his long lost wife mysteriously makes contact, and he sets out to find her, leading him to a creepy bayou cabin and a nasty run-in with the unsavoury residents, the Baker family. It never gets any easier for Resident Evil Village’s main protagonist, Ethan Winters. As their disgusting, hairy legs scrabble madly against the walls, it becomes apparent that, in Metro Exodus, you can never let your guard down. Your arachnid foes are fatally vulnerable to light, so they skulk about in any dimly-lit crevice they can find. Then, in the spider-infested bunkers beneath the Caspian Sea, it becomes your weapon. Early stages of the game teach you to extinguish light and master the shadows.

Yet, as we pointed out in our Metro Exodus PC review, this is a game that is at its most terrifying when it changes the rules. Human enemies might be on the back foot, but the chill of a howling Watchmen or the charge of a Humanimal is excruciatingly unsettling. But, if you choose to sleep through the daylight hours to creep up on your opponents in pitch darkness then expect a much scarier experience. However, there are plenty of spine-tingling horror game sequences creeping en route to the climactic Metro Exodus ending.ĤA Games’ irradiated outing allows you to choose whether you want Artyom’s adventure to be a guns-blazing assault or a stealthy affair shrouded in darkness thanks to the game’s day/night mechanic. Metro Exodus is a number of games packed into one inviting post-apocalyptic slice of Russia: it’s a story-focused family drama as much as it is a Wolfenstein-esque, heavy metal-scored FPS. Be careful, though, all your prying will likely upset the ghost, and you don’t want to be around when it starts hunting. Using equipment, such as ouija boards, a spirit box, a crucifix, and smudge sticks – you and your team need to investigate the haunting and complete tasks such as taking a picture of dirty water, or asking the ghost questions. It requires teamwork, your best detective hat, and steady nerves to navigate the dark, tight corridors and eerily quiet rooms. Phasmophobia has grown beyond a cult following and is showing no signs of slowing down, so what makes it so good?Īlthough Phasmophobia is primarily a horror game, you could look at it as a co-op detective game as you and up to three other investigators explore a haunted location in an effort to deduce what type of ghost is spooking out the premises before reporting back.
